Front of House Manager (F&B)

ISS World Services A/S
Washington, United Statesfull_timeVerifiedPosted 23 Jan 2024

About the role

As the Front of House Manager, you will play a crucial role in creating an exceptional experience for our guests. Your ability to lead and inspire our front-of-house staff will be instrumental in ensuring smooth operations and delivering outstanding customer service.

Key Purpose 

 

The Food Services Manager is expected to: 

  • To drive customer service, employee engagement, safety programs, signage, micro kitchen supervision 

  • To satisfy the needs of the client and customer by providing high quality, cost effective food service operations.  

  • To participate and lead in establishing corporate employee training and development programs as instructed by the General Manager. 

 

 

Success Criteria 

 

  • Effective Team building 

  • Solve any customer complaints or issues 

  • Follow all food safety regulations 

  • Staff scheduling 

  • Hire and training new employees 

 

 

Key Areas of Collaboration and Influence 

 

  • Work with the GM and Executive Chef on team programming and safety.  

  • Work with GM on duties assigned. 

 

 

Ideal Candidate Experience 

 

  • Experience in food systems with a high school diploma or equivalent. 

  • Attention to detail 

  • Bachelor's degree or culinary degree preferred 

  • Ability to multitask 

  • Ability to forecast supplies as needed 

  • Ability to manage a budget 

  • Interpersonal skills 

  • Ability to give and receive constructive feedback 

  • Ability to create restaurant policies for employees to follow 

  • Shows ability to lead a team 

 

 

 

Key Accountabilities 

 

  • Day to day support of all front of the house and micro kitchen activities. 

  • Tasks assigned as needed by the GM. 

  • Must comply with all ServSafe and HACCP programs and standards. 

  • Building strong customer relationships and delivering customer-centric solutions. 

  • Develop good customer relationships and address customer service needs. 

  • Manage purchasing, inventory, maintenance and other operational functions to ensure monthly budgets are met 

  • Demonstrate a high level of accountability and self-awareness. 

  • Build teams to be customer focused and solutions oriented, all while being flexible in constant change. 

  • Maintain service standards and CPEs of the client. 

 

 

 

 

Physical Demands & Work Environment 

 

  • Work up to 8 hours a day on your feet, excluding breaks. 

  • Must be able to lift a minimum of 25lbs. 

  • Come to work properly dressed according to the dress code. 

  • Employee must be able to work under pressure and time deadlines during peak periods.
